NAFR HIGH COURT OF CHHATTISGARH, BILASPUR CONT No. 86 of 2018

1. Saradhuram Mandavi S/o Late Shri Mangal Singh Aged About 44 Years Caste Gond, Acting Principal (Lecturer Panchayat) Government Higher Secondary School Jamgaon Block Narharpur, Tahsil Narharpur, District North Bastar Kanker, Chhattisgarh.

---- Petitioner

Versus

1. Richa Prakash Choudhary Chief Executive Officer, Jila Panchayat Kanker, District North Bastar Kanker, Chhattisgarh. ---- Respondent For Petitioner Shri Ramesh Kumar Sharma & Shri Manoj Mishra, Advocates Order On Board By Prashant Kumar Mishra, J.

23/03/2018 1.

Learned counsel appearing for the petitioner would argue that the order passed by this Court on 8-11-2017 in WPS No.5920 of 2017 has not been complied with inasmuch as the representation preferred by the petitioner has not yet been decided.

2.

Let the petitioner move fresh application before the respondent drawing her attention towards the necessity of complying the order passed by this Court. The application be filed within 15 days from today along with certified copy of the order passed in this contempt petition. On moving such application, the contemnor shall decide the representation at the earliest as early as possible preferably within a period of four weeks thereafter.

3.

It is made clear that if the representation is not decided within the stipulated period, despite the above application of the petitioner, strict view shall be taken against the erring official as and when the petitioner moves fresh contempt petition for which liberty is reserved in his favour. 4.

Accordingly, the contempt petition stands disposed of. Sd/- Judge Prashant Kumar Mishra Gowri
